This publication record appears to combine work from multiple distinct research areas, including molecular biology topics like ubiquitin signaling and cancer biology, alongside unrelated materials science and nanotechnology studies. Because the topic labels and paper subjects vary so widely (from bone regeneration and pancreatic cancer biology to graphene composites and membrane filtration), it is likely that this data reflects contributions from several different researchers sharing the same name rather than a single coherent research program. Prospective students should verify with the researcher directly which specific publications and topics represent their actual work.
Publication output has grown substantially over the last decade, rising from around 10 papers per year in 2017 to roughly 30-35 per year in 2023-2025.
